请启用Javascript以获得更好的浏览体验~
品创集团
0755-3394 2933
在线咨询
演示申请
软件公司开发平台:构建高效、创新与安全的软件开发新生态
软件公司开发平台:构建高效、创新与安全的软件开发新生态

本文将深入探讨软件公司开发平台的核心价值、功能特点、技术架构以及未来发展趋势,旨在帮助读者全面了解如何利用开发平台提升软件开发效率、促进技术创新并确保软件安全。

软件公司开发平台:构建高效、创新与安全的软件开发新生态
一、引言

在当今数字化时代,软件已成为企业竞争力的核心要素之一。为了快速响应市场需求、提升产品竞争力,软件公司纷纷寻求高效、灵活且安全的软件开发解决方案。开发平台作为连接开发者、资源与市场的桥梁,正逐渐成为软件公司不可或缺的重要工具。本文将全面解析软件公司开发平台的特点与价值,为软件开发者提供有益的参考。

二、软件公司开发平台的核心价值

  1. 提升开发效率:开发平台通过提供预构建的组件、模板和自动化工具,大大缩短了软件开发周期,降低了开发成本。同时,平台还支持多人协作开发,提高了团队协作效率。

  2. 促进技术创新:开发平台集成了最新的技术框架、编程语言和开发工具,为开发者提供了丰富的技术选择。这有助于激发创新灵感,推动软件产品的持续迭代和优化。

  3. 确保软件安全:开发平台内置了严格的安全机制和防护措施,如代码审计、漏洞扫描和权限管理等,有效保障了软件产品的安全性。此外,平台还支持与第三方安全服务集成,进一步提升了安全防护能力。

三、软件公司开发平台的功能特点

  1. 项目管理:开发平台提供了全面的项目管理功能,包括任务分配、进度跟踪、代码审查和版本控制等。这有助于开发者更好地管理项目资源,确保项目按时交付。

  2. 代码托管与协作:平台支持代码托管、版本控制和分支管理等功能,方便开发者进行代码共享、协作开发和版本迭代。同时,平台还提供了代码审查工具,有助于提升代码质量和团队协作效率。

  3. 持续集成与持续部署(CI/CD):开发平台集成了CI/CD流程,支持自动化构建、测试和部署。这有助于加快软件发布速度,提高软件质量和用户体验。

  4. 监控与运维:平台提供了全面的监控和运维功能,包括性能监控、日志分析、故障排查和自动化运维等。这有助于开发者及时发现并解决问题,确保软件系统的稳定运行。

四、软件公司开发平台的技术架构

软件公司开发平台通常采用微服务架构和云原生技术,以实现高可用性、可扩展性和灵活性。平台的技术架构包括前端展示层、后端服务层、数据存储层和安全防护层等。其中,前端展示层负责提供用户友好的界面和交互体验;后端服务层负责处理业务逻辑和数据交互;数据存储层负责存储和管理数据资源;安全防护层则负责保障整个平台的安全性。

五、软件公司开发平台的未来发展趋势

  1. 智能化与自动化:随着人工智能和机器学习技术的发展,开发平台将更加注重智能化和自动化。例如,通过智能推荐算法为开发者提供个性化的开发建议和工具;通过自动化测试工具提高测试效率和准确性等。

  2. 低代码/无代码开发:低代码/无代码开发模式将逐渐成为主流。这种开发模式通过提供图形化界面和拖拽式组件,降低了开发门槛,使得非专业开发者也能快速构建应用程序。

  3. 多云与混合云支持:随着云计算技术的不断发展,开发平台将支持多云和混合云环境。这将有助于企业更好地利用不同云服务商的优势资源,实现资源的灵活调度和优化配置。

  4. 安全与合规性:随着数据安全和隐私保护法规的不断完善,开发平台将更加注重安全和合规性。例如,通过加密技术保护数据传输和存储安全;通过合规性检查工具确保软件产品符合相关法规要求等。

六、结论

软件公司开发平台作为连接开发者、资源与市场的桥梁,在提升软件开发效率、促进技术创新和确保软件安全方面发挥着重要作用。未来,随着技术的不断进步和市场需求的变化,开发平台将不断演进和完善,为软件开发者提供更加高效、灵活和安全的开发环境。